About Short Press-On Nails
Short vs Medium Length
Short nails stay flush at the fingertip, which reduces daily snagging on keyboards, packages, and zippers. Medium length adds visible nail art space but requires more care in physical tasks.
Short Press-Ons vs Extra-Short
Standard short extends just past the fingertip, giving a groomed appearance without bulk. Extra-short stays fully within the fingertip outline and suits the most active or tactile-heavy lifestyles.
How to apply
- Clean and dry each nail and push back the cuticles.
- Match each nail to its closest size before applying.
- Apply nail glue for up to two weeks of wear, or an adhesive tab for a gentler 5-7 days.
- Press firmly from cuticle to tip for 30 seconds; avoid water for the first 2 hours.
How to remove without damage
- Soak in warm, soapy water for 10-15 minutes to soften the adhesive.
- Gently lift from one side — never force or peel.
- Buff away any residue and moisturize.
How long they last
- Up to two weeks with glue; 5-7 days with adhesive tabs.
- Reusable when removed gently and stored in the case.
- Wear time varies by prep, adhesive choice, and daily use.
